Episode Synopsis "Napoleon Dynamite - The Genius of Thematic Opposites"
Thematic Opposites are great tools used by writers to improve the thematic weight and significance of many different characters. From the heroic protagonist, to the villainous antagonist, to anyone in between, thematic opposites are a great way to improve the characters of a story. But have you ever thought about the thematic opposition of the brilliant movie Napoleon Dynamite? I am here to talk to you about that very idea. Enjoy!
